MARKET SUMMARY

McDonough (Henry County)/Atlanta, GA

McDonough is located in Henry County, Georgia. It has direct rail service from Norfolk Southern Railroad and the metro’s best access to the Port of Savannah, you are less than two hours away by air and two days by truck to 80 percent of the United States. McDonough is home to number of major national and international companies including Home Depot, Whirlpool, Ken’s Foods, ALOLA and Luxottica Retail Group. McDonough can also boast about being the center of education with mercer University, southern Crescent Technical Col-lege, Clayton State University , Academy for Advanced Studies, and Gordon State College.

The Atlanta Metropolitan Statistical Area (MSA) includes 20 counties. The projected 2015 population for the Atlanta MSA by the Atlanta Regional Commission is 5,697,710. The neighborhood has experienced an above average pattern of growth primarily due to the neighborhood's proximity to the Interstate system and the Central Business District of McDonough. Georgia’s Economy is expected to grow 3.2 percent in 2017 ahead of the nation’s 2.6 percent GDP growth rate. There are more FORTUNE 500 companies headquartered in Atlanta than Dallas and Nashville combined. Serving 110 million passengers annually and func-tioning as headquarters for Delta Air ales, the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ta airport connects more people than any other in the world. Corporate facility investors and site consultants awarded Georgia as the #1 state for business climate four years in a row and the #1 state for business three years in a row. This business-friendly environments helps our companies grow and high-lights the vitality of Georgia’s economy.

Over the past few years, Atlanta’s thriving entertainment industry has been rapidly growing. In the past year alone, big ticket films like Guardians of the Galaxy: Vo.2, The Fate of the Furious, Spi-der-Man: Homecoming, Hidden Figures, Marvel’s Black Panther and Pitch Perfect 3 filmed in and around Atlanta. The list of TV produc-tions based here is also impressive: The Walking Dead, Stranger this, MacGyver, plus all of Tyler Perry’s series for OWN and TLC call At-lanta area home. According to Georgia’s Film, Music and Digital Entertainment Office, 245 film and TV productions were shot in Georgia during fiscal year 2016 (between July 1, 2015 and June 30, 2016). Those productions spent $2.02 billion during that time and generated an economic impact of $7.2 billion.
